Stayed 6 nights over F1 weekend. The facilities are modern and have a nice aesthetic. However, service could be much better. Upon entering the first time, there was a guy complaining about his stay for 15+ min. Reception did not seem to acknowledge me when I arrived and allowed two others to jump ahead. The female daytime receptionist and male night receptionist were not friendly and barely acknowledge you. The male also gave me a hard time for replacing my towel on night 3 of 6. He does not even say anything when I thank him. The best receptionist was the girl at night. She was always smiling and kind. The capsules are spacious and relatively clean. I did get some bites on my ankles, saw one bug, but it did not look like a bed bug thankfully. The capsule rooms are very quiet, not conducive to socializing at all. I felt afraid to speak in there. The walls are very thin, can hear the chimes of the elevator and the bathroom doors slamming (those really need some soft close function). I am a heavier sleeper so these did not bother me, but if you are a light sleeper, be prepared. Though it was loud during the F1 weekend, I did not hear much music or partying in the capsule. They provide two hangers in the capsule, but drying items would take days (just an FYI for those washing items). The bathrooms have 2 shower and 2 toilet stalls. It was ample for my stay, only waited for the shower once. It was generally clean, but upon arrival, it appeared some other guest bled on the toilet and down the outer bowl... It was not cleaned for days. That was gross, but I avoided that stall. The common area on Floor 5 had many tables, big communal ones to small private desks for working. The area could be messy at times, garbage bins overflowing. The drink machine was very nice to have, my fav was the Tarik. The early morning breakfast was also appreciated. I enjoyed the savoury middle option (chicken pie puffs were the best, also had tuna or curry puffs). The sweet options were a bit dry and I did not like much. Overall a decent capsule hotel. I don't think I could have found better for F1 weekend at the price I paid. But I also don't think I would return due to the service and cleanliness (many reviews with bugs). I would consider the other Kinn property instead.

KINN Habitat is a polished, modern capsule hostel in a central Singapore spot, with Clarke Quay, the riverside, bus stops, MRT links, Chinatown, Fort Canning, Marina Bay and Merlion Park within easy reach. The building feels new and design-led, with strong air conditioning, clean lines, and a quieter, more work-friendly mood than a party hostel. The capsules are the main trick: privacy shutters, comfortable beds, mirrors, sockets, hooks, and sometimes a foldable table make the bunk feel more usable than a plain dorm bed. Lockers sit near the beds, and the bathrooms can feel unusually upscale when cleaning is on point. The 5th-floor lounge and terrace add real utility: light breakfast snacks, hot drinks, water access, and space for laptop time. The lobby coffee can also be a good start to the day. Staff support is often warm and practical, though the tech-heavy self check-in and keypad systems can slow things down.
Signals to check
- Rooms and pods can be very small, with limited floor space for luggage.
- Ventilation is a real risk: dorms may feel stuffy, too cold, too hot, humid, or affected by strong chemical, mold, ammonia, or urine smells.
- This is not a strong social hostel; the mood is more clean, central, and functional than activity-heavy.
- Doors, lockers, keypads, elevators, thin walls, and late-night movement can make sleep difficult in some rooms.
- Bathrooms may be hot, cramped, wet, short on shelf space, or inconsistently clean.
- Upper bunks and some low floor-bed layouts can be awkward or unsafe to climb in and out of.
- Breakfast is simple, usually pastries or small snacks and basic drinks, so do not expect a full meal.
- There are serious past complaints about bugs and bed cleanliness, so check the bed area carefully on arrival.
